Mae Tordella, 80, was welcomed home to heaven on Sunday, December 9, 2012 surrounded by her loving family.

She was born in Brooklyn and lived in Eatontown before moving to Jackson and Manchester

She attended St. Dorothea's Roman Catholic Church in Eatontown.

Mae worked as a pharmaceutical technician at Family Pharmacy in Ocean for many years before her retirement. She loved spending time with her family, going to the beach, listening to music and going to Cape May. She was an amazing mother, grandmother, sister and friend. Her amazing words to all, “I love you more…and a day-249 xxoo.”

She was predeceased by her husband, Anthony Tordella in 1972 and her parents, Michael and Marion Rampino.



Surviving are her loving sister, Josephine Rampino and her children, Christine and John Girone, Robert and Menchit Tordella, Carol and Gregory Krause, MaryAlice Tordella and Anthony Tordella; 14 grandchildren and 4 great-grandchildren.

Family and friends are invited to attend a memorial Mass at 9:30 am Saturday at St. Dorothea's Church, Eatontown. In lieu of flowers, donations in her memory may be made to your favorite charity. Please visit www.fiorefuneralhomes.com
